Civil Inspector | Engineering Consultancy

The ideal candidate will have strong experience in site inspection, quality control, and construction supervision for building projects within the UAE. The successful applicant will ensure that all civil works are executed in accordance with approved drawings, project specifications, local authority regulations, and industry quality standards.

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ct routine site inspections to verify that civil works comply with approved drawings, specifications, contract requirements, and applicable codes.
  • Monitor construction activities and ensure high standards of workmanship, safety, and quality.
  • Inspect excavation, foundations, reinforced concrete, blockwork, structural elements, finishing works, and external civil works.
  • Review material approvals and verify that approved materials are used on site.
  • Witness site tests and inspections as required and maintain accurate inspection records.
  • Identify non-conforming work and coordinate corrective actions with contractors.
  • Prepare daily inspection reports, snag lists, NCRs, and site observation reports.
  • Coordinate with Resident Engineers, Project Engineers, Architects, MEP Inspectors, contractors, and relevant authorities.
  • Review shop drawings, method statements, material submittals, and as-built drawings when required.
  • Monitor project progress and report any delays, technical issues, or quality concerns.
  • Ensure compliance with UAE building regulations, engineering standards, and health & safety requirements.
